Handover — uniforms, Farrowgate Depot

Mira, picking up where I left off: the full uniform order for the new Farrowgate depot arrived from Tollin & Weave and is staged in the back room, sorted by size. Two jackets are back-ordered; the rest is complete. The courier collecting the crates for Farrowgate comes Thursday morning. Before you release anything, note the confidential hand-over instruction below:

handover note for yagef-bagep: the drudor pelius courier leaves the kasdor zorvan norir ledger at gate 8016 under passcode 755406

[ ] DNS flakiness check — before you approve, make sure the Harkwell resolver sidecar is pinned and not floating on latest again. We got bitten last cycle when cache TTLs went weird and the Orbit Pine staging boxes intermittently failed lookups for the billing service. The workaround (retry with backoff in the client) is fine, but the real fix only landed recently, so double-check staging is actually running the patched image noted below.

trace token, kawip-fafog: htk14_26e64c4d35154e

### Alert Dedupe 101

Welcome to the support rotation! Our deduplicator, affectionately called Squelch, collapses duplicate pages from Hornbeam monitors so you don't get woken up five times for one flappy disk. If a ticket mentions "storm mode," Squelch is batching alerts into ten-minute windows — totally normal. You can inspect the dedupe queue from the Squelch console, but for scripted lookups you'll hit the internal API directly. Use the key below when calling the dedupe endpoints from your terminal.

service key, fawip-bajef: kto11_Qt5wZK9vdNC

- [ ] Step 7: Archive cold storage buckets (Glacierline tier). Confirm both ceremony witnesses are present, verify bucket manifests match the Oxbow ledger, then seal the archive key shares. Plugin authors may observe but not handle shares. Once sealed, the archive index itself is encrypted and can only be reopened with the passphrase below.

vault phrase of badup-hahig = tamael-aldael-kelmir-istael-fenok-istwyn-tamius-jorath-oliion